C# 常用 的 类型 int string 日期 字典
1.Dictionary<string, string> 好处是没有 具体的类那样,用起来不用束缚住
比如 经常接口接收参数的话 会 建立一个对应的 dto类对象 去接收
而且一般是集合的话 list<model> 这样接收的
但是有的情况下 建立model 类对象接收 过于麻烦 用字典项接收
2.但是 处理数据的时候 就不如类 那么的清晰明了 因为类的话 成员属性 是 model.A 这样就使用A成员的
字典项 是根据 key值 处理value 这个key值肯定是点不出来的
所以如果是集合字典项 那么遍历集合 每一个字典项的key值需要循环
举例:1个集合字典 dataList 里面有5个字典项<string,string>
foreach (var data in dataList)
{
//拿到5个字典项
foreach (var item in data.Keys)
{
//循环5个key值 拿到对应的value
string value = data[item];
}
}
集合倒叙: dataList.Reverse();
字典赋值:
dic["a"]="a"
集合添加:
dataList.add("b","b")